SHOULD I REPAIR MY SYSTEM OR SHOULD I REPLACE IT?
Here are some things to consider when considering this question:
How old is my system?
Repairs hold more value for younger systems, as there is less of a chance for the system to have issues that are lurking, waiting to hit you when you’ve already spent money on another part.
Replacement is a much better option for older system facing expensive repairs, as there is a higher chance of something else going wrong in the future.

Is this the first repair completed for my system?
Repairs can stack up over time. If the current repair you are facing is the first, it means more than if it’s the third or fourth major issue you’ve come across.
Replacement is a great option for systems that have a history of being unreliable. If you’ve had to complete a number of serious repairs for your system, it may be time to put the system out to pasture and start fresh with a new one.
How did my system work before?
Repairs will frequently bring your system back online. At most, your system will likely be working as well as it was before.
Replacement is a great option if your system wasn’t working well before. That could mean a number of things, including dramatic temperature swings or hot/cold spots in areas.

What are my potential savings?
Repairs will rarely provide any kind of savings. They are meant to get your system back up and running.
Replacement offers savings down multiple avenues. For one, technology and regulations have pushed systems to be more efficient. That means you’ll be saving the difference between the current cost of operation and the new cost of operation. In addition to that, there are a number of manufacturer and utility rebates available, depending on the town you live in!
